Responsibilities:

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Inventory & Demand Management: Oversee the visibility and management of inventory levels across regions, ensuring that demand capture in new markets is effectively monitored and integrated into the supply planning process. Provide actionable recommendations to improve stock health and ensure a seamless supply chain.
  • Geographic Expansion & New Market Integration: Play a critical role in expanding into new territories by ensuring supply chain processes are adapted to meet local market requirements. Collaborate with Commercial, Logistics, and Operations teams to manage and execute market entries, ensuring smooth transitions and optimal demand capture in emerging markets.
  • Supply Risk Management: Monitor and develop the Demand Inventory (DI) process, proactively flagging risks to senior stakeholders and devising plans to mitigate supply chain disruptions. Work closely with North American teams to ensure we can pull in supply as needed and develop contingency plans to mitigate risks associated with global market expansion.
  • Data & Reporting for New Markets: Establish and refine data and reporting mechanisms to track supply and demand in newly integrated markets. Ensure real-time visibility into stock performance, providing insights that drive decision-making for these markets and ensuring they align with broader business goals.
  • S&OP Process Support: Support the Regional and Country-level S&OP (Sales & Operations Planning) process, ensuring alignment of demand and supply forecasts for both existing and new markets. Ensure that supply chain strategies meet the evolving needs of expanding markets.
  • Performance Monitoring & Demand Alignment: Continuously monitor performance versus forecast for new territories, ensuring discrepancies are addressed swiftly to keep supply and demand aligned. Recommend adjustments to supply chain strategies based on performance insights to optimize outcomes in new regions.
  • KPI Development & Process Improvement: Lead the creation and refinement of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) that track the effectiveness of the supply planning process, especially in the context of new market integration and geographic expansion. Implement process improvements that ensure scalability and readiness for future growth.
  • Cross-Regional Collaboration: Collaborate with stakeholders across global teams, including North America, to ensure alignment on supply planning strategies. Develop comprehensive risk mitigation strategies to support the growth of the business, particularly in expanding regions.
